PM Shehbaz requests President Biden to release Dr Aafia on humanitarian grounds
Dr Aafia has been incarcerated in FMC Carswell since September 2010

Islamabad: Prime Minister Shahbaz Sharif has urged US President Joe Biden to pardon and release Dr Aafia Siddiqui.
In a letter, the premier stated that Dr. Aafia Siddiqui had been sentenced to 86 years in prison by a US District Court. As PM, he believes it is his responsibility to intervene in this matter.
Sharif urged President Biden to use his constitutional authority to grant a pardon and order her release on humanitarian grounds.
He further mentioned that Dr Aafia Siddiqui's family, along with millions of Pakistanis, are awaiting this act of kindness.
